    Job Description Summary:

    Provides security and safety services in all areas of the hospital, hospital properties and the hospital's off-campus sites as assigned. Creates and maintains a safe, secure environment for the hospital's patients, visitors, and staff through utilization of equipment and techniques that prevent weapons from being brought into OhioHealth facilities. Provides guidance, way-finding and other customer services functions as the initial point of contact for care site visitors.

    Responsibilities And Duties:


    90%
    Operates and maintains weapons scanning equipment.
    Enforces OhioHealth facility policies regarding parking regulations, visitation policies, drug enforcement, tobacco free/smoking policy, weapons free and others.
    Monitors facility activity on closed circuit television to be alerted to any escalating situations that may require security involvement.
    Intervenes in patient, visitor and/or staff confrontations as appropriate.
    Completes appropriate documentation of incidents.
    Demonstrates understanding of emergency procedures, alarm response, evacuation, and internal and external disaster plans.
    Work independently to determine the correct response to most situations and initiate actions accordingly.
